Asus PRO7AJR bricked after Easyflash !
#1
My dear friends !

I unfortunately bricked my Asus Notebook!  Huh

The mainboard is an K72Jr from ASUS with Rev. 2.0 .
BiosChip = SST25VF032B (32Mbit /4Mb EEprom )

The history:
I flashed the bios with EasyFlash.
After the flash it shut down and never wake up to reboot!  Angry  Angry
No light no function no charging light .....  ----> nothing happens when i press the power button ! Exclamation

I thought by myself :  No problem !  Idea
I downloaded the BiosFile (size 2Mb)from Asus site and programmed the desoldered chip.

Now !:
The white LED from the power button lights when i plug in the charger !
(without battery and without pressing the power button)

After 30 sec. the fan begins to run permanently but no picture on the display and also no signal on the VGA port.
Cpu and graphicchip becomes warm....but not hot !
Now i press the power button for 7 sec. the fan stops running but the white power LED still lights.
And the green Numlock and Shiftlock Leds are blinking slowly.
Graphics chip and CPU stays warm.

I programmed the Bios for 3 times with different firmware, but same Ship same station ..!

Maybe its a Crashfree Bios ? Or its not the full Bios File ? Or the Bios Chip is damaged ?
And.... why is the BiosChip 4Mb but the BiosFile only 2Mb ? Confused

Any idea or suggestion ?  Huh

Dear Sml6397 !

Thank you for your help !

But i got a similar but faulty board last hour !
The board had a hardware failure, but the Bios Chip was OK.
So, i read this Chip in my programmer and stored the *.bin in the "dead" Chip !

Now the board is OK again ! Smile

Shall i post this File ?

Its Bios version 205
from :
Model : Asus PRO7AJ
MB Ver. : K72JR ID:1A
PRO7AJR - TY206V
